However, the car and engine are only one level of innovation in the smart cockpit, and the smart cockpit is not the same as the car and engine. The smart cockpit should be a complete automated closed-loop system including perception, thinking, and action. It covers vehicle driving and entertainment information, and can provide users with an efficient and convenient human-vehicle interaction experience.

To put it simply, the smart cockpit can provide you with services from the moment you enter the car, such as unlocking the door without any sense, automatically logging in to your account, adjusting seats, rearview mirrors, air conditioning, vehicle settings, etc. Synchronize navigation information and meet the diverse entertainment needs of passengers.

Among the 7 cars tested, only the Tesla Model 3, Weilai ET7, Xpeng P5 and Ideal ONE can be unlocked through mobile phone Bluetooth. Wenjie M5 has not yet launched this function.

[Pacific Automotive Network Review Channel] In 2012, the first-generation Tesla Model S was delivered. The huge 17-inch vertical screen packaged and integrated all the messy physical buttons in the interior. Along with various controversies, a revolution in the intelligentization - DayDayNews

In the Bluetooth unlocking of mobile phones, Tesla Model 3 and Ideal ONE require the user to touch the door handle to unlock, while the Xpeng P5 will automatically unlock and pop up the door handle when it is closer to the door (the distance is affected by the environment) signal impact). NIO ET7 currently needs to open the APP when approaching the vehicle to unlock. So we see that even if you use mobile phone Bluetooth to unlock, the final implementation methods are also different. From a safety point of view, it is more secure for the user to unlock when he pulls the door handle, but it will make the user feel more comfortable to unlock automatically when he gets close. Full of ceremony.

BYD Han and Wenjie M5 can currently add digital keys through mobile phone NFC. When you need to unlock, you can take out your mobile phone and touch it on the rearview mirror housing to open the door. This function only supports Huawei mobile phones . BYD Han supports Huawei , Honor , Xiaomi , OnePlus, VIVO, OPPO and other brands of mobile phones. So if you are a Apple Samsung user, it will be more embarrassing.

Among the 7 models tested, Tesla Model 3 and Ideal ONE multi-account switching is the most convenient. Just select account switching directly on the car. After switching accounts, seats, rearview mirrors, and some vehicle settings will also be adjusted synchronously with the account. Most vehicle settings of Ideal ONE can be synchronized (such as tailgate opening height, driving mode, lights, etc.). Switching accounts for other models requires scanning the QR code on the mobile phone APP to log in. NIO ET7 and Wenjie M5 also support facial recognition login.

The characteristics of the 2022 model in terms of car and machine performance Tesla Model 3 is the strongest. Its car adopts AMD's customized hardware solution and also has a customized AMD independent graphics card. Its overall performance is unparalleled and matches the other 6 models. Of course, behind such hardware, the cost will naturally rise.

[Pacific Automotive Network Review Channel] In 2012, the first-generation Tesla Model S was delivered. The huge 17-inch vertical screen packaged and integrated all the messy physical buttons in the interior. Along with various controversies, a revolution in the intelligentization - DayDayNews

NIO ET7 and Xpeng P5 cars use Qualcomm SA8155 chip, which is Qualcomm ’s third-generation cockpit processing solution. At present, Qualcomm’s latest cockpit chip is 8195, which belongs to the fourth-generation cockpit solution, but no mass production model has been delivered yet. The Ideal ONE uses the earlier Qualcomm 820A chip, which is a car-grade chip launched by Qualcomm in 2016. Compared with the 820A chip, the performance of 155 is nearly 3 times improved.

[Pacific Automotive Network Review Channel] In 2012, the first-generation Tesla Model S was delivered. The huge 17-inch vertical screen packaged and integrated all the messy physical buttons in the interior. Along with various controversies, a revolution in the intelligentization - DayDayNews

BYD Han has not officially announced the car chip information, but after we downloaded and installed the hardware test APP on the car, the query did not show the specific Qualcomm chip information. We can only confirm that it uses the 8nm LPP process and is equipped with 2 A77 and 6 Kyro 480 cores, and the GPU uses Adreno 619. Comparing this information with the existing Qualcomm Snapdragon chips, none of them can fully correspond. I believe it is a customized chip. Comparison of two chips

Wenjie M5 is more unique, it uses It is the Kirin 990A chip from Huawei HiSilicon. However, this is different from the Kirin 990 chip on the mobile phone. Compared with the Kirin 990 on the mobile phone, the 990A architecture is different, and although the 990A and the 990 have the same GPU, the number of 990A GPU cores is half of the 990. In addition, , the manufacturing processes of the two are also different.

As for Volkswagen’s ID.6 CROZZ, the official has not officially announced the car chip information. There are many different opinions on the Internet, some say it uses Qualcomm 820A and some say it uses Samsung V9. Unless we disassemble the phone, we won't be able to confirm what chip is used. But it has to be said that the vertical screen of Xpeng P5 is closer to the user, and the screen size is large enough, so most functions can be completed in the first and second level menus, so finding functions will be more efficient. In addition, the larger the screen, the larger the touch area for functions, such as the keyboard, which will make searching for addresses faster.

Ideal ONE takes the longest. In fact, the reason is not that the interaction level is too complicated, but because the mobile phone waits too long to connect to Bluetooth. Ideal is the only model among the 7 cars that has a functional screen. The advantage of this screen is that commonly used vehicle settings and air-conditioning and seat settings can be completed inside, while software functions such as map navigation need to be processed back to the central control screen. Such functional partitioning is helpful to improve operational efficiency. In fact, the time spent on the Ideal ONE can be shortened, because it is faster to adjust the temperature and air volume through gestures on the function screen.

Although the interfaces of NIO ET7, Wenjie M5, and BYD Han are quite different, the commonly used functions we set are basically placed on the homepage, and users can quickly jump between various functions.

Tesla Model 3 adheres to the minimalist of . Some settings such as temperature and air volume have a smaller touch area, and there is no sound or vibration feedback, so the use time becomes longer.

The last thing I want to talk about is the Volkswagen ID.6 CROZZ. The basic settings of Volkswagen are actually very good. The air-conditioning interface is simple and easy to distinguish between various functions. The seat heating is also integrated on the same page. But on the settings page, Volkswagen's little thinking is more difficult to understand: using a 3D vehicle model to display the available settings, you have to go around a few times to find the corresponding settings, which is not more efficient than directly displaying text.

Therefore, innovation is necessary in the interaction level of car-machine systems, but when thinking on the cutting edge, those fancy interactions will only make users more disgusted.

Back to the system, let’s take a look at a very simple vehicle setting. Tesla Model 3, NIO ET7, Ideal ONE, Wenjie M5, and BYD Han all integrate all vehicle settings into the settings page. Users will know that as long as they change the settings, they can find the answer here. Xiaopeng P5 and Volkswagen ID.6 CROZZ divide the settings into two entrances: vehicle control and system settings. Although the starting point is to hope that users can interact more efficiently, it does not meet users' expected habits and the actual efficiency may be even lower.

[Pacific Automotive Network Review Channel] In 2012, the first-generation Tesla Model S was delivered. The huge 17-inch vertical screen packaged and integrated all the messy physical buttons in the interior. Along with various controversies, a revolution in the intelligentization - DayDayNews

On this point, NIO merged “My Car” and “Settings” in the Aspen 3.0.0 system of the 668 model because they found that after users clicked on the application interface list, more than 75% of them It is to open "Settings", so integrating vehicle settings on one page will help improve efficiency.

From the results, it is obvious that the direct touch control of the 7 models takes longer than Voice control takes a short time, and the time difference between Weilai ET7, Xpeng P5, Ideal ONE, and Wenjie M5 is relatively small. The reason is that voice control can recognize two commands at one time or can control continuous commands. For Tesla Model 3, BYD Han, and Volkswagen ID.6 CROZZ, which have weak voice functions, they can only wake up one function at a time, which will take longer. Therefore, it is not that voice interaction cannot be used, but whether it is usable or not. The continuous command tests the system's ability to understand upper and lower commands. We chose the command "Turn the temperature down a little, then lower it a little more."

Continuous command
Tesla Model 3 Weilai ET7 Xpeng P5 Ideal ONE Question M5 BYD Han Volkswagen ID.6 CROZZ
Temperature adjustment A little lower, a little lower × × ×

In this regard, Weilai ET7, Xpeng P5, Ideal ONE, and Wenjie M5 can successfully execute our commands and correctly get the meaning of the commands. Tesla Model 3 does not have continuous commands, so this link can be passed directly. BYD Han and Volkswagen ID.6 CROZZ both exited after recognizing and executing the first command, and failed to recognize the second command after reawakening the voice. In the aspect of

Automotive intelligence has two sections: smart driving and smart cockpit. So far, smart driving has been in a state where the threshold is high and difficult to implement, and consumers are not willing to pay for it. In contrast, the threshold for smart cockpits is lower and user perception is more obvious, so smart cockpits have naturally become the stepping stone for smart cars.
